Alkhidmat organizes medical camps for flood victims; thousands undergo check-up

Alkhidmat Karachi has organized medical camps in flood-hit areas where thousands of flood victims have undergone check-ups. Doctors, paramedical staff and Alkhidmat’s volunteers have been mobilized for this purpose and free medicines are being given where necessary. Besides organizing medical camps, Alkhidmat is also conducting a massive rescue and relief operation in these flood-hit area. Many corporates have contributed with aid packages, such as Dalda which has donated 11.80 tins of cooking oil to Alkhidmat. Alkhidmat has also set up more than 100 relief camps in the city where citizens are flocking in large numbers with their donations in cash and kind. Alkhidmat has also established a big kitchen in Sukkur through which cooked food and drinking water are being provided to flood victims of the area. Hundreds of volunteers are working round the clock along with local Alkhidmat officials to provide tents, rations and other necessities to flood victims. Ameer Jamaat-e-Islami Hafiz Naeem ur Rehman has visited Alkhidmat Karachi’s head office in the presence of Alkhidmat Karachi Executive Director Rashid Qureishi and other officials and met volunteers involved in sorting, packing and dispatching relief supplies in trucks and other vehicles to flood-stricken areas. Hafiz Naeem reiterated Alkhidmat’s commitment to continue the relief operation which was already underway in the most severely hit areas and appealed to those with means to come forward at this difficult moment and donate generously and wholeheartedly to Alkhidmat’s flood relief activities.
